LINGO Live is a collaborative community radio broadcast from the LINGO spoken word festival on Friday Oct 16th in the Workman’s Club, Dublin. The 4 hour live broadcast will feature performances and interviews with spoken word poets, festival organisers and audience members. Performers and guests on the night will include Tongue Fu, John Cummins, John Moynes and The Brownbread Players. Tune in from 7pm to Near FM 90.3 or listen on Phoenix FM or Dublin South FM.
